出自-2016年12月听力原文柯林斯高阶英汉双解学习词典释义
N-PROPER
上帝;天主;真主
The name God is given to the spirit or being who is worshipped as the creator and ruler of the world, especially by Jews, Christians, and Muslims.
例句
He believes in God...他信奉上帝。God bless you.上帝保佑你。CONVENTION
(表示强调所说的话,或表示惊讶、恐惧或激动)啊呀,天啊,天哪(可能具冒犯意味)
People sometimes use God in exclamations to emphasize something that they are saying, or to express surprise, fear, or excitement. This use could cause offence.
例句
God, how I hated him!...啊呀!我恨死他了!Oh my God he's shot somebody...我的天哪!他开*打人了。N-COUNT
神
In many religions, a god is one of the spirits or beings that are believed to have power over a particular part of the world or nature.

极受尊崇的人;影响极大的人
Someone who is admired very much by a person or group of people, and who influences them a lot, can be referred to as a god .
例句
To his followers he was a god.在追随者眼中,他就是神。PHRASE
愿上帝阻止这样的事情;但愿这样的事不会发生
If you say God forbid, you are expressing your hope that something will not happen.
例句
If, God forbid, something goes wrong, I don't know what I would do.如果哪儿出点儿岔子,我会不知所措的,但愿这样的事情不会发生。PHRASE
上帝的恩赐;十全十美的人
If a person thinks they are God's gift to someone or something, they think they are perfect or extremely good.

(表示强调)只有上帝知道,天晓得
You can say God knows ,God only knows, or God alone knows to emphasize that you do not know something.
例句
Gunga spoke God knows how many languages...天晓得贡嘎会讲多少门语言。God alone knows what she thinks.只有天晓得她在想什么。PHRASE
(表示不知道答案)天晓得
If someone says God knows in reply to a question, they mean that they do not know the answer.
例句
'Where is he now?' 'God knows.'“他现在在哪里?”“天晓得。”PHRASE
